數(shù)學(xué)模型垃圾車調(diào)度問題_第1頁
數(shù)學(xué)模型垃圾車調(diào)度問題_第2頁
數(shù)學(xué)模型垃圾車調(diào)度問題_第3頁
數(shù)學(xué)模型垃圾車調(diào)度問題_第4頁
數(shù)學(xué)模型垃圾車調(diào)度問題_第5頁
已閱讀5頁,還剩2頁未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

1、作業(yè)題之一垃圾運(yùn)輸調(diào)度問題1 .問題重述某城區(qū)有36個(gè)垃圾集中點(diǎn),每天都要從垃圾處理廠(第37號(hào)節(jié)點(diǎn))出發(fā)將垃圾運(yùn)回。不考慮垃圾的裝車時(shí)間。現(xiàn)有一種載重6噸的運(yùn)輸車,運(yùn)輸車平均速度為40公里/小時(shí)(夜里運(yùn)輸,不考慮塞車現(xiàn)象);每臺(tái)車每日平均工作4小時(shí)。運(yùn)輸車重載運(yùn)費(fèi)元/噸公里;運(yùn)輸車空載費(fèi)用元/公里;并且假定街道方向均平行于坐標(biāo)軸。運(yùn)輸車應(yīng)如何調(diào)度(需要投入多少臺(tái)運(yùn)輸車,每臺(tái)車的調(diào)度方案,運(yùn)營費(fèi)用)?表1-1?垃圾點(diǎn)地理坐標(biāo)數(shù)據(jù)表?序號(hào)站點(diǎn)編R垃圾量T坐標(biāo)(km)序號(hào)站點(diǎn)編R垃圾量T坐標(biāo)(km)xyxy1132201519922152132225335422222104447232327956

2、0824241519653112525151477792626201788962727211399102282824201010140292925161111173303028181212146313151213131293221171614141012333325715207143434920161621635359151717618363630121818111737370019191512?2 .模型的基本假設(shè)與符號(hào)說明基本假設(shè)1 .車輛在拐彎時(shí)的時(shí)間損耗忽略。2 .車輛在任意兩站點(diǎn)中途不停車,保持穩(wěn)定的速率。3 .只要平行于坐標(biāo)軸即有街道存在。4 .無論垃圾量多少,都不計(jì)裝車時(shí)間。5

3、.每個(gè)垃圾站點(diǎn)的垃圾只能由一輛運(yùn)輸車運(yùn)載。6 .假設(shè)運(yùn)卒&車從A垃圾站到B垃圾站總走最短路線。7 .任意兩垃圾站間的最短路線為以兩垃圾站連線為斜邊的直角三角形的兩直角邊之和。8 .每輛垃圾運(yùn)輸車每次運(yùn)的足夠多,且不允許運(yùn)輸車有超載現(xiàn)象;9 .假設(shè)在運(yùn)輸垃圾過程中沒有新垃圾入站。10 .假設(shè)運(yùn)輸車和鏟車在行駛過程中不出現(xiàn)的塞車、拋錨等耽誤時(shí)間的情況;11 .各垃圾站每天的垃圾量相對(duì)穩(wěn)定。符號(hào)說明Tk:第k個(gè)垃圾集中點(diǎn)的垃圾量,k1,2,36;Xk:第k個(gè)垃圾集中點(diǎn)的橫坐標(biāo),k1,2,36;Yk:第k個(gè)垃圾集中點(diǎn)的縱坐標(biāo),k1,2,36;L:垃圾運(yùn)輸路線總條數(shù);G:第i條路線上垃圾集中點(diǎn)的

4、個(gè)數(shù),i1,2,L;N:安排運(yùn)輸車的總數(shù)量;Xj:第i條路線上的第j個(gè)垃圾集中點(diǎn)的橫坐標(biāo),i1,2,L,j1,2,Ci;Yj:第i條路線上的第j個(gè)垃圾集中點(diǎn)的縱坐標(biāo),i1,2,L,j1,2,CiTj:第i條路線上的第j個(gè)垃圾集中點(diǎn)的垃圾量,i1,2,L,j1,2,Ci;hi:第i條路線所需要的總時(shí)間;Hn:第n輛車的運(yùn)輸總時(shí)間;W1:運(yùn)輸車空載的總費(fèi)用;W2:運(yùn)輸車重載的總費(fèi)用;W:運(yùn)輸車的總費(fèi)用;3模型的建立確定運(yùn)輸車路線算法由于最遠(yuǎn)的垃圾集中點(diǎn)的運(yùn)輸時(shí)間不超過運(yùn)輸車每天平均工作時(shí)間,所以可以先不考慮時(shí)間的約束。從而建立如下算法:1)確定重載起點(diǎn)由于每個(gè)垃圾集中點(diǎn)的垃圾量及其坐標(biāo)是不變,重載

5、運(yùn)輸?shù)馁M(fèi)用是不變的,所以為了使總運(yùn)輸費(fèi)用W最少,只要使空載的費(fèi)用最少,即盡量安排較遠(yuǎn)的垃圾集中點(diǎn)在同一路線上,從而確定重載起點(diǎn)Xi1.2)確定運(yùn)輸車路線走向要求運(yùn)輸時(shí)走最短的路線,以及運(yùn)輸費(fèi)用最低,而且由于運(yùn)輸車的重載費(fèi)用元/噸是空載費(fèi)用元/噸的倍,為了使運(yùn)輸總費(fèi)用W最少,那只能從最遠(yuǎn)的點(diǎn)(j1)開始運(yùn)載垃圾,下一個(gè)點(diǎn)編號(hào)為j1,走一條路線,向垃圾處理站(坐標(biāo)原點(diǎn))方向運(yùn)回。順次經(jīng)過的點(diǎn)遵循滿足條件:XijXij1YijYij1即其橫坐標(biāo)以及縱坐標(biāo)均不超過前一點(diǎn)的橫、縱坐標(biāo),并且各點(diǎn)橫、縱坐標(biāo)遞減進(jìn)行搭配,由若干個(gè)點(diǎn)組成一條路線。3)確定運(yùn)輸車路線垃圾集中點(diǎn)數(shù)根據(jù)每個(gè)垃圾集中點(diǎn)的垃圾量,每條路

6、線上的垃圾總量不超過運(yùn)輸車的最大Ci運(yùn)輸量:Tij6,i1,2,Lji根據(jù)上面算法,建立運(yùn)輸車費(fèi)用優(yōu)化模型:LminW0.4*X”i1XijXij1st.YijYij1,i1,2,LCiTij6j1運(yùn)輸車調(diào)度方案在運(yùn)輸過程中假設(shè)沒有運(yùn)輸車等待的情況,在四個(gè)小時(shí)的工作時(shí)間里,根據(jù)垃圾運(yùn)輸費(fèi)用優(yōu)化模型,得到垃圾集中點(diǎn)分配的路線及其時(shí)間hi,為了達(dá)到安排運(yùn)輸車最少,把所有的路線分成N(NL)類,每類配置一輛運(yùn)輸車,每輛運(yùn)輸車的工作時(shí)間Hn:LHnhiEi,i1,2,Li10,第i條路線不在n類日。1,第1條路線在門類,n1,2,NHn44.模型的求解運(yùn)輸車路線的計(jì)算首先根據(jù)題所給的數(shù)據(jù)畫出散點(diǎn)圖垃圾

7、點(diǎn)地理坐標(biāo)252015109I2415161d!81120A21725-9715.,L1-5j015-334,i-7-429二750454-914-4217-3-4j00014-215101520253035求解程序(見附錄1),得到以下運(yùn)行結(jié)果3029273000000028126322550r001000362333210000000241835150000000341716200r0010002011100000000019138000r0000014741000000022000000000012190000r001000316000000000運(yùn)輸車的最優(yōu)路線如下圖所示:表1-2運(yùn)輸

8、路線安排及其費(fèi)用運(yùn)輸路線先后經(jīng)過的垃圾站點(diǎn)序號(hào)空載費(fèi)用(元)重載費(fèi)用(元)運(yùn)輸路程(km)運(yùn)輸所需時(shí)問(h)T線0-22-042二號(hào)線0-31-6-034三號(hào)線0-12-9-0840四號(hào)線0-20-11-10-056五號(hào)線0-19-13-8-054六號(hào)線0-14-7-4-1-044七號(hào)線0-34-17-16-2-016258八號(hào)線0-24-18-35-15-026168九號(hào)線0-36-23-33-21-084左線0-30-29-27-3-092線0-28-26-32-25-5-088由此得出,運(yùn)輸車空載的總運(yùn)費(fèi)為各路線總和的一半乘以空載的運(yùn)輸費(fèi)用:LW10.4*Xi1Yi1132元i1運(yùn)輸車重

9、載的總運(yùn)費(fèi)為各路線的最遠(yuǎn)點(diǎn)開始至垃圾處理站各自線路上的各個(gè)垃圾集中點(diǎn)將線路劃分的若干部分,各部分運(yùn)輸車上垃圾量乘以該部分的路程,冉將各部分所得的積的總和乘以運(yùn)輸車重載的運(yùn)輸費(fèi)用:36W21.8*Tk*(XkYk)2213.4元.k1運(yùn)輸車總的運(yùn)輸費(fèi)用為:WW1W2122.42212.652345.4元。運(yùn)輸車調(diào)度最優(yōu)方案根據(jù)計(jì)算各路線所需時(shí)間的,在運(yùn)輸車每日平均工作四小時(shí)左右的前提下,得出路線的最優(yōu)搭配,從而得出所需最少的卡車數(shù)量。由上表1-2中運(yùn)輸所需時(shí)問,我們得到如下路線搭配,如表1-3:表1-3運(yùn)輸車路線及其時(shí)間安排運(yùn)輸線路車輛安排運(yùn)輸車線路時(shí)間總時(shí)間1一、一十2小時(shí)18分1小時(shí)03分3

10、小時(shí)21分21K、十2小時(shí)12分1小時(shí)06分3小時(shí)18分3二、三、五1小時(shí)21分1小時(shí)51分3小時(shí)12分4七、八1小時(shí)42分1小時(shí)27分3小時(shí)9分5四、九2小時(shí)6分1小時(shí)24分3小時(shí)30分由表1-3得出,最少安排五輛運(yùn)輸車對(duì)垃圾集中點(diǎn)進(jìn)行運(yùn)輸,達(dá)到最優(yōu)運(yùn)輸方案5.附錄附錄1:運(yùn)輸車調(diào)度方案的程序clearx=31540379101417141210726111519222127151520212425285172599300;y=25478119620369121416181712950919141713201618121672015120;t=;i=1:37;a=1:37;plot(x,y,

11、'*r')forii=1:37k=int2str(ii);k=strcat('P',k);text(x(ii),y(ii),k);endw=i;x;y;t;a;w(5,:)=0;jg=zeros(11,11);%?11i?fori=1:20sum=0;j1=1;s=0;m=37;i3=37;forj=1:36if(w(2,j)+w(3,j)>s&w(5,j)=0)s=w(2,j)+w(3,j);jg(i,j1)=w(1,j);sum=w(4,j);m=j;elsecontinue;endendw(5,m)=1;j1=j1+1;while1js=0;

12、q=40;fork=1:36if(q>w(2,m)-w(2,k)+w(3,m)-w(3,k)&w(2,m)>w(2,k)&w(3,m)>w(3,k)&(6-sum)>w(4,k)&w(5,k)=0q=w(2,m)+w(3,m)-w(2,k)-w(3,k);js=1;jg(i,j1)=w(1,k);i3=k;elsecontinue;endendw(5,i3)=1;sum=sum+w(4,i3);j1=j1+1;m=i3;if(w(2,i3)=0&w(3,i3)=0|js=0)breakendendendkcost=0;zcost=0;allcost=0;n=0;foru1=1:11foru2=1:11ifjg(u1,u2)=0n=jg(u1,u2);elsecontinueendzcost=zcost+w(4,n)*(w(2,n)+w(3,n);endn=jg(u1,1);kcost=kcost+*(w(2,n)+w(3,n);end

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

評(píng)論

0/150

提交評(píng)論